CVE-2017-9286 describes a privilege escalation vulnerability in the openSUSE packaging of NextCloud. Specifically, the unsafe use of /srv/www/htdocs could allow scripts running as the wwwrun user to escalate privileges to root during a NextCloud package upgrade on openSUSE Leap. This vulnerability has a high CVSS score of 8.8, indicating a critical impact with high confidentiality, integrity, and availability compromise, and can be exploited remotely with low privileges and no user interaction. There is no evidence of active exploitation, public exploit code (Metasploit, Nuclei, ExploitDB), or significant community discussion or media coverage.
